Myron L. Kemerer, Myron.L.Kemerer.1@gsfc.nasa.gov. NASA/GSFC plans to
issue a Request for Proposal (RFP) for Products and services grouped
into service levels according to function and performance requirements.
These include Desktop systems, including Science and Engineering
workstations,Servers performing general use functions (e.g., Email and
Internet),Database and other servers as appropriate,Intra-center
communications systems, including Local area networks Voice, FAX,
Pagers, Audio/Video, and RF/Wireless systems, Cable plant services,
ODIN system engineering Standard support services and Server system
administration. Also included are Help Desk support, training, system
administration network support services, including network management.
Additionally, there will be the requirement to provide in the manner
proposed by the offeror, hardware and standard COTS software,
installation, maintenance, shared services (e.g., file, print, etc.),
and network access. Technology refreshment will occur on the seats
provided as well as the communications infrastructure. This will be an
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ity contract for use by all NASA
centers, and available to tenant Government agencies on NASA or
NASA-supported sites (e.g., the Air Force at Patrick Air Force Base).
The contract will have a nine year ordering period with the delivery
orders having one three year basic period and two three year option
periods. The draft RFP was issued on 8/29/97 with the actual RFP being
